Ukraine sowed over 12 million hectares of spring grains and oilseeds
UkrAgroConsult
The sowing of spring crops is nearing completion. In particular, it has already ended in Poltava and Kirovograd regions. As of the first day of summer, Ukrainian farmers have already sown 5 million 472 thousand hectares of grain and pulses, including
- spring wheat – 269.5 thou hectares
- spring barley – 766.1 thou hectares;
- peas – 136.1 thousand hectares;
- oats – 145.6 thou hectares;
- corn – 3 892.5 thousand hectares;
- buckwheat – 106.1 thousand hectares;
- millet – 46.1 thou hectares;
- other grains and pulses – 109.7 thou hectares.
Last week, the total area under grains and pulses was 193.6 thou hectares.
Sugar beet was planted on the area of 213.1 thou hectares. As for oilseeds, sunflower was planted on the area of 5 042.8 thou hectares, and soybeans – on the area of 1 739.3 thou hectares.
